Explore real-world vulnerabilities and attack vectors in decentralized applications (Dapps) through this 24-minute DEF CON 32 conference talk. Gain essential knowledge about the intersection of Web2 and blockchain components in Dapps, understanding their unique security challenges through practical case studies. Learn fundamental concepts of Dapp architecture, develop effective threat modeling approaches, and discover common vulnerability patterns drawn from years of hands-on Dapp hacking experience. Whether new to Web3 security or an experienced Web2 pentester, acquire valuable insights and resources to effectively identify and assess security risks in blockchain-based applications.
